An Introduction To Automata Theory And Formal Languages Adesh K Pandey Pdf [portable] Jun 2026

Finite automata (FA) are simple machines with a finite number of states used for pattern matching and hardware design. Deterministic and Non-deterministic FA:

A critical tool used to prove that a language is not regular.

At its core, this field studies abstract, mathematical models of computation and the languages they can recognize. Instead of focusing on physical computer hardware or specific programming languages, automata theory analyzes the fundamental capabilities and limitations of computation itself. The Core Components

, the book is praised for its approachable tone and structured progression from basic sets to advanced Turing machines. Why This Book is a Student Favorite Logical Progression Finite automata (FA) are simple machines with a

Consists of an infinite tape, a read/write head, and a state control Unit.

The book "Introduction to Automata Theory and Formal Languages" by Adesh K Pandey has several key features and highlights:

Automata theory is the study of abstract computational devices and the formal languages they can recognize. Adesh K. Pandey’s text simplifies these highly abstract concepts by categorizing them into a structured hierarchy (often aligning with the famous Chomsky Hierarchy). Instead of focusing on physical computer hardware or

These languages use a stack data structure to handle nested structures.

The text relies heavily on clear, unambiguous state transition graphs and tables.

is a widely used textbook for computer science students that simplifies the complex logic of the Theory of Computation (TOC). Published by S.K. Kataria & Sons The book "Introduction to Automata Theory and Formal

In the vast landscape of computer science literature, few subjects are as foundational yet conceptually demanding as Automata Theory and Formal Languages. Often regarded by students as a dense thicket of mathematical abstraction, this field is, in reality, the bedrock upon which modern computing stands. It defines the boundaries of what computers can and cannot solve. Adesh K. Pandey’s An Introduction to Automata Theory and Formal Languages serves as a vital bridge across this theoretical chasm. The text is not merely a collection of definitions and theorems; it is a structured roadmap designed to guide the undergraduate mind from the concrete world of programming into the abstract realm of computational logic. This essay explores the depth, structural integrity, and educational significance of Pandey’s work, analyzing how it demystifies the science of computation.

Most technical universities provide legal ebook access to students through platforms like OpenLibrary, SpringerLink, or university network subscriptions.